Course Content

• IT Service Communication Strategies & Planning
• Effective Communication Channels for IT Services (email, instant messaging, portals)
• Crisis Communication & Incident Management in IT
• IT Service Communication: Stakeholder Management & Engagement
• Technical Writing & Documentation for IT Professionals
• Presentation Skills & Public Speaking for IT
• Negotiation & Conflict Resolution in IT Service Environments
• Measuring the Effectiveness of IT Service Communication
